In this final Onward episode of 2023 co-hosts Cardiff Garcia and Fundrise CEO Ben Miller kick things off by discussing Ben’s major market call: The conclusion that the real estate market has hit bottom. After 18 months of escalating interest rates punishing the real estate industry, small businesses, and regional banks, we’ve entered a new period where we expect the move to falling rates to propel strong positive performance.

Ben walks Cardiff through his view of the state of the economy, both macro and specific to real estate, furnished with data points drawn from top-down market analysis, bottom-up, and anecdotal evidence, referencing confidential third-party sources and Fundrise’s own portfolio of assets. Most importantly, after a year of market turbulence, the market’s trough means that it’s time for investors to shift their attitude and become opportunistic about buying along the bottom.
